West Palm Beach, Fla. - Former Vice Presidential nominee Sarah Palin made her way to West Palm Beach Wednesday for a couple of private speaking events.
On Monday, President Obama will be in Miami for a private fundraiser at the home of NBA legend Alonzo Mourning.
Political experts say the Republican and Democratic parties are scheduling more appearances in the Sunshine State.
"There's a lot of money here and there are a lot of people here who write political checks," said Sid Dinerstein, the Chairman of the Republican Party of Palm Beach County.
The Chair of the Democratic Party of Palm Beach County, Mark Alan Siegel, says its critical for both parties to be visible to Florida voters because it helps attract attention at the grassroots level.
"Ultimately, Florida's soon to be 29 electoral votes will be in play for the election of 2012 and everybody who seeks to be a nominee or to win the office will be here," said Siegel.
